On prolongations of second-order regular overdetermined systems with two independent and one dependent variables
Abstract
The purpose of this present paper is to investigate the geometric structure of regular overdetermined systems of second order with two independent and one dependent variables from the point of view of rank 2 prolongations. Utilizing this notion of prolongations, we characterize the type of these overdetermined systems. We also give a systematic method for constructing the geometric singular solutions by analyzing of a decomposition of this prolongation. As an applications, we determine the geometric singular solutions of Cartan's overdetermined systems.
